In many cases however, individuals develop a strong physical and in many cases psychological dependency to drugs and alcohol which makes these seemingly convenient drug rehab in Dayton, New Jersey options inviable.
While at first in any sort of drug rehab in Dayton, those who are just recently abstaining from alcohol are detoxed and ideally assisted through this, with withdrawal made more manageable with the assistance of detox professionals. Even with someone is detoxed however, they are still going to encounter intense cravings to consume alcohol or use drugs, cravings which can persist for quite a while. Some individuals claim that they experience such cravings for the remainder of their lives, but ideally cope through these with the life tools and workable coping methods they obtain in an effective Dayton, NJ. drug rehab. Let's say someone is in an outpatient drug rehab in Dayton, New Jersey while still encountering these extreme cravings, and go back home on a daily basis during rehab. Reports say that substance abuse is frequently triggered by environmental elements, for example life stressors, and even individuals their environment who may trigger it. This may be an abusive relationship, somebody that encourages and participates in the person's habit or any other situation that may prompt the individual to turn to alcohol or drugs as a social aid, as an escape or to self medicate. This makes an outpatient situation the least optimum, because the whole purpose of drug rehab in Dayton should be to resolve all of these scenarios while there. This is why relapses are really common with outpatient drug rehab.
Also, short-term drug rehab in Dayton, NJ. which offers rehabilitation for 1 month or less are really the least ideal rehab settings even when receiving inpatient or residential rehabilitation. As stated earlier, people who have recently abstained from alcohol need a substantial amount of time to recover physically and also stabilize from the dependence a result of their substance abuse. After just a few weeks, individuals in drug rehab in Dayton, New Jersey are merely acclimating to a drug free lifestyle, and learning how to adjust physically, mentally, and emotionally without their drug of choice. This leaves not much time for them to clearly concentrate on what can actually assist them to conserve a drug free and healthy way of life when they return home, which will take quite a while for many who might need to make significant and life changing choices and changes in lifestyle.
